Trishelle Cannatella is a reality television star and actress who loves the game of poker. Cannatella has now become the latest celebrity endorser for the poker online poker room Absolute Poker. Cannatella will now play online poker at Absolute Poker as well as endorse the poker room during live tournaments.
Trishelle is best known for being on MTV's The Real World the Las Vegas season. It was there that Trishelle became interested in the game of poker. She has also starred in Ninja Cheerleaders, The Dukes of Hazzard: The Beginning as well as magazines such as Maxim, Playboy and Elle Girl. Trishelle has also appeared on Punk’d, Fear Factor, Criminal Minds and Dr. Steve-O.
She also competed in the game show Celebrity Poker Showdown. Trishelle won the Caesars Palace Classic in Las Vegas, her very first tournament, and since then she has competed in several poker events. In 2008 she competed in the World Poker Tour Celebrity Invitational and she returned in 2009 to compete.
Trishelle commented on signing with the poker room by stating: "I’m very excited to be Absolute Poker’s new celebrity endorser. Poker has always been a passion of mine and I can’t think of a better team to be a part of."
